Theatre Company will join forces to present a
concert version of Bill Leavengood’s Webb’s City:
The Musical, which was written and directed by Bill
with music and lyrics by Lee Ahlin. They created the show
for the Pinellas County Millennium Celebration in 1999. It
is based upon the life and times of J.E. “Doc” Webb, who
opened his first drug store in 1925 and kept expanding his
62 TAMPA BAY MAGAZINE | SEPTEMBER/OCTOBER 2017
enterprise over the next five decades until it covered ten city
blocks in St. Petersburg and attracted 60,000 visitors a day.
The musical was performed in 2000 at both Ruth Eckerd
Hall in Clearwater and the Mahaffey Theater in St. Petersburg
and then again the next year at the Mahaffey, where more
than 10,000 people saw it. Webb’s City: The Musical was
again performed at the St. Petersburg Little Theatre a few
years later.
